Defining Hospital Liability for Equipment Failure
Hospital liability for equipment failure refers to the legal responsibility hospitals hold when malfunctioning medical equipment causes harm to patients. This liability can arise from negligence, improper maintenance, or failure to follow safety protocols. Hospitals must ensure their equipment is regularly inspected and properly maintained to prevent failures that could lead to adverse outcomes.
When equipment failures result in patient injury or death, courts evaluate whether the hospital breached its duty of care. Factors considered include whether the hospital adhered to standard operating procedures, kept accurate maintenance records, and responded appropriately to known risks. Failure to meet these standards may establish hospital liability for equipment failure.
It is important to distinguish hospital liability from manufacturer responsibility. While manufacturers may be liable under strict liability for defective equipment, hospitals are accountable for operational negligence. An understanding of these distinctions clarifies the scope of hospital liability for equipment failure within the broader context of healthcare safety and patient protection.

Factors Contributing to Equipment Failure in Hospitals
Various factors contribute to equipment failure in hospitals, ultimately impacting patient safety and hospital liability. Foremost, inadequate maintenance and regular calibration can lead to malfunctioning equipment, as failure to adhere to manufacturer guidelines increases the risk of breakdowns.
Environmental conditions within the healthcare facility also play a significant role. Fluctuations in temperature, humidity, or exposure to dust and contaminants can degrade sensitive components, reducing the lifespan or performance of critical medical devices.
Additionally, technological obsolescence and improper handling during installation or repairs may compromise equipment integrity. Using outdated or incompatible parts can inadvertently cause malfunctions, underscoring the importance of trained personnel and proper procedures.
Finally, manufacturing defects or design flaws, though less common, can lead to sudden equipment failure. In such cases, hospitals may bear liability if they failed to identify or mitigate known risks, emphasizing the need for thorough procurement processes and quality assurance.

Causation and foreseeability in liability assessment
Causation and foreseeability are critical elements in determining hospital liability for equipment failure. Causation links the equipment malfunction directly to patient harm, establishing a clear connection that liability can be attributed to the hospital or manufacturer. Foreseeability involves assessing whether the hospital could have anticipated the failure and taken steps to prevent it.
In liability assessments, courts typically consider whether the equipment failure was a direct cause of injury using a "but-for" standard, meaning the injury would not have occurred without the malfunction. Additionally, hospitals may be held liable if they reasonably should have foreseen the risk of equipment failure and failed to take appropriate preventive measures.
Key points in this evaluation include:
- Establishing a direct causal relationship between equipment failure and patient injury.
- Assessing whether the hospital or manufacturer could have predicted the failure based on prior knowledge or maintenance records.
- Determining if the injury outcome was reasonably foreseeable, considering the nature of the equipment and regulatory standards.
This framework helps clarify legal responsibilities and ensures accountable parties address preventable equipment failures effectively.
Comparing Hospital and Manufacturer Responsibilities
The responsibilities of hospitals and medical device manufacturers in equipment failure cases differ significantly. Hospitals are primarily responsible for proper maintenance, regular inspections, and timely replacements to ensure equipment functions correctly. Their duty includes staff training and adherence to protocols to prevent malfunction-related harm.
In contrast, manufacturers bear responsibility for ensuring that their equipment is designed, produced, and tested to meet safety standards. They must issue accurate instructions and warnings regarding potential risks and proper usage. When equipment failures result from design defects, manufacturing errors, or inadequate warnings, liability often falls on the manufacturer.
Legal distinctions also influence liability assessments. Hospitals may face negligence claims if they fail to uphold maintenance standards, while manufacturers could be held liable under strict liability laws for defective products. Both parties play essential roles, but liability hinges on specific circumstances and the nature of the failure. This comparison underscores the importance of clear regulations and diligent practices to mitigate risks for patients and healthcare providers.

Insurance and Legal Protections for Hospitals
Hospitals often utilize various insurance policies to manage the financial risks associated with equipment failure. These insurance protections are designed to cover costs arising from malfunctions, damages, or liabilities linked to medical equipment. Such coverage helps hospitals mitigate the economic impact of liability claims and equipment-related incidents.
Legal protections for hospitals include statutes that limit liability in specific circumstances, such as statutory caps on damages or immunity provisions for hospitals acting in good faith. These legal frameworks aim to encourage hospitals to maintain high standards without the fear of excessive litigation, while still safeguarding patient rights.
Additionally, hospitals often implement contractual indemnity agreements with equipment manufacturers and suppliers. These agreements specify responsibilities and allocate liability, often shifting some risk away from the hospital. This strategic approach complements insurance policies and legal protections to reduce overall liability exposure.
Effective utilization of insurance and legal protections is vital for hospitals to navigate the complexities of equipment failure liability. They provide a safety net that supports hospital operations while ensuring compliance with legal standards and promoting patient safety.
